在现代网络架构中,服务器添加子域名是常见的操作,它有助于组织网站内容、改善用户体验和优化搜索引擎排名,下面将详细解释如何为服务器添加子域名的步骤,并讨论一些相关的注意事项。
服务器添加子域名的步骤
1、规划子域名:确定需要添加的子域名,例如blog.example.com
或shop.example.com
,这些子域名通常用于区分网站的不同部分或服务。
2、DNS配置:登录到您的域名注册商提供的控制面板,找到DNS管理区域,创建一个新的A记录或者CNAME记录指向您的服务器IP地址或现有域名,如果您的主域名是example.com
,您可以创建一个CNAME记录blog
指向example.com
。
3、服务器配置:一旦DNS设置完成,需要在服务器上配置相应的虚拟主机,对于Apache服务器,这意味着编辑httpd.conf
文件或使用.htaccess文件来添加新的虚拟主机条目,对于Nginx服务器,则需要编辑nginx配置文件来添加server块。
4、SSL证书安装:如果您计划通过HTTPS访问子域名,确保为子域名安装SSL证书,这可以通过Let's Encrypt等免费证书颁发机构获得,或者购买商业证书。
5、测试与验证:完成上述步骤后,使用在线工具如Pingdom或GTmetrix检查DNS传播情况,并确保子域名可以正确解析到您的服务器,检查服务器日志以确保没有错误发生。
6、维护与监控:定期检查子域名的性能和安全性,确保它们运行正常且未受到攻击。
相关问答FAQs
Q1: 我是否需要为每个子域名单独购买SSL证书?
A1: 不一定,如果您的主域名已经有一个通配符SSL证书(如*.example.com),那么它可以覆盖所有子域名,如果没有,您可能需要为每个子域名单独购买或申请免费的Let's Encrypt证书。
Q2: 添加子域名会影响我的SEO吗?
A2: 添加子域名本身不会直接影响SEO,但是如何使用它们可能会,如果子域名被用来提供与主网站相关的内容和服务,并且有良好的内部链接策略,那么它们可以增强用户体验和SEO表现,如果子域名内容质量低下或者与主网站主题不相关,可能会对SEO产生负面影响,合理规划和使用子域名是很重要的。
小伙伴们,上文介绍了“服务器添加子域名”的内容,你了解清楚吗?希望对你有所帮助,任何问题可以给我留言,让我们下期再见吧。